Output 83fa0a247922820092f42f9c92fc61a7c1705753553fd9ff9b9f274956947b31:0

value
21668493
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 94c1d341420b0694f393ff86cdc7499670c4a2cc OP_EQUALVERIFY OP_CHECKSIG
address
1EZZCbyATEh9TYbQV9fXVTuyVSFKQA7DQ2
transaction
83fa0a247922820092f42f9c92fc61a7c1705753553fd9ff9b9f274956947b31
spent
true